Mallow Cultural Companions: A Social Network for Older People

 Mallow Cultural Companions: A Social Network for Older People

On Wednesday 12th October at 2pm a social and informational event is taking place in Mallow Library that aims to kickstart a new Cultural Companions hub for the local Mallow community. Cultural Companions is an Age and Opportunity Initiative that brings together like-minded people that meet up regularly to go out together as a small group. Aimed at the 50+ age group this event is free and open to all.

The afternoon will feature live performances of music and poetry from local artists

along with lots of information on Cultural Companions; how it works and how to get involved. If you enjoy going to the movies, plays, comedy, live music, art exhibitions and so on and you would get out to enjoy more events if you had company to go with, then Cultural Companions is for you.

Tara O’Donoghue, Coordinator of Cork Cultural Companions, says “There’s a great selection of social events going on in and around Mallow and North Cork and we want everyone to share the same opportunities to get out and enjoy them. Cultural

Companions are developing this local hub in Mallow to try to help older people to connect and meet up to attend events together locally.The programme is free and without obligation, so you can be as involved as much or as little as you like.When you become a member you’ll get regular updates on events local to you and you will be put in contact with other people who share your interests and would also enjoy
company to attend events.”

Cultural Companions is an Age & Opportunity Arts Initiative,supported by Creative Ireland, Cork City and County Councils, The Community Work Department Cork North Cork & Kerry Community Healthcare and Healthy Ireland. The programme is delivered by Cork County Federation of Muintir na Tire. Membership is free.
